网站大量收购独家精品文档,联系QQ:2885784924

第2课 自然语言描述算法(说课稿)2023-2024学年五年级上册信息技术浙教版.docx

第2课 自然语言描述算法(说课稿)2023-2024学年五年级上册信息技术浙教版.docx

  1. 1、本文档共3页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

第2课自然语言描述算法(说课稿)2023-2024学年五年级上册信息技术浙教版

一、教材分析

第2课自然语言描述算法(说课稿)2023-2024学年五年级上册信息技术浙教版

本课选自五年级上册信息技术浙教版教材,旨在引导学生了解自然语言描述算法的基本概念和原理,培养学生的逻辑思维和编程能力。通过本课的学习,学生能够掌握自然语言描述算法的基本方法,并能够运用所学知识进行简单的自然语言描述编程。

二、核心素养目标

三、学习者分析

1.学生已经掌握了哪些相关知识:

五年级学生在此前已接触过一些基本的计算机操作和简单的编程概念,如使用图形化编程环境进行基本编程。他们对编程有初步的兴趣,但尚未深入学习自然语言描述算法的相关知识。

2.学生的学习兴趣、能力和学习风格:

学生对计算机科学和技术领域的内容普遍保持较高兴趣,特别是当编程与解决问题相结合时。学生的编程能力参差不齐,部分学生具备一定的逻辑思维和编程基础,而另一些学生则可能较为陌生。学习风格上,有学生偏好动手实践,通过操作来学习,也有学生更倾向于理论学习,通过阅读和理解来学习。

3.学生可能遇到的困难和挑战:

学生在理解自然语言描述算法的概念时可能遇到困难,尤其是算法的抽象性和逻辑复杂性。此外,编程实践可能因为编程错误或对算法理解不足而遇到挑战。学生可能需要多次尝试和指导来克服这些困难,因此,教学中需要提供足够的支持和反馈。

四、教学资源

-软硬件资源:计算机教室,配备电脑、投影仪和连接网络。

-课程平台:学校信息平台或编程学习平台,用于学生在线学习和作业提交。

-信息化资源:自然语言描述算法的相关教学视频、案例库、编程工具软件。

-教学手段:PPT课件、实物教具(如编程机器人)、互动式教学软件。

五、教学过程

一、导入新课

(老师)同学们,今天我们要一起探索一个有趣的话题——自然语言描述算法。在日常生活中,我们经常用到描述,比如描述一幅画、一个故事或者一个事件。那么,计算机是如何理解和处理这些描述的呢?让我们一起走进今天的课堂,揭开这个秘密。

二、新课导入

1.引导学生回顾已学知识

(老师)同学们,还记得我们在上节课学习了什么吗?是的,我们学习了编程的基本概念和简单程序设计。今天,我们将在此基础上,进一步了解自然语言描述算法。

2.介绍本节课的学习目标

(老师)今天,我们希望通过以下三个方面的学习,来深入理解自然语言描述算法:

(1)了解自然语言描述算法的基本概念;

(2)掌握自然语言描述算法的基本原理;

(3)尝试运用自然语言描述算法进行简单的编程。

三、新课讲授

1.自然语言描述算法的基本概念

(老师)同学们,自然语言描述算法是一种让计算机能够理解和处理人类自然语言的技术。这种技术可以将人类的描述转化为计算机可以理解和执行的操作。

2.自然语言描述算法的基本原理

(老师)接下来,让我们来探讨一下自然语言描述算法的基本原理。首先,我们需要了解自然语言的复杂性,包括语法、语义、语境等。然后,通过一系列的算法和技术,将自然语言转化为计算机可以处理的结构化数据。

3.自然语言描述算法的编程实践

(老师)现在,我们已经了解了自然语言描述算法的基本概念和原理,接下来,让我们来尝试运用这些知识进行简单的编程。请同学们打开编程软件,跟随老师的步骤进行操作。

(学生)我打开编程软件,按照老师的步骤开始编程。

4.案例分析

(老师)同学们,现在我们来分析一个案例。假设我们要编写一个程序,描述“小猫在花园里捉蝴蝶”。请同学们思考一下,我们应该如何用自然语言描述算法来实现这个功能?

(学生)同学们积极思考,提出不同的解决方案。

5.课堂互动

(老师)很好,同学们提出了很多有创意的解决方案。接下来,我们将选取其中一个方案,进行实际编程。请同学们跟随老师的步骤,一起完成这个任务。

(学生)我按照老师的步骤,开始编写程序。

四、课堂小结

(老师)同学们,通过今天的学习,我们了解了自然语言描述算法的基本概念、原理和编程实践。希望大家能够将所学知识运用到实际生活中,发挥计算机在处理自然语言方面的优势。

五、作业布置

(老师)同学们,今天的作业是:请结合所学知识,编写一个简单的自然语言描述算法程序,描述一个你喜欢的场景。

六、课堂评价

(老师)同学们,今天的表现非常出色,大家都积极参与课堂互动,认真完成编程任务。希望大家在课后继续努力,将所学知识学以致用。下课!

六、学生学习效果

学生学习效果

1.知识掌握:

学生能够理解和描述自然语言描述算法的基本概念,包括其定义、作用和重要性。他们能够区分自然语言描述算法与其他类型的算法,如程序性算法和数据结构算法。

2.技能提升:

学生在编程技能上有了显著提升,能够运用自然语言描述算法进行简单的编程实践。他们学会了如何将自然语言转化为计算

文档评论(0)

老师驿站 + 关注
官方认证
内容提供者

专业做教案,有问题私聊我

认证主体莲池区卓方网络服务部
IP属地河北
统一社会信用代码/组织机构代码
92130606MA0GFXTU34

1亿VIP精品文档

相关文档